Overview
A scientific program that focuses on the anatomy, physiology, biochemistry, and biophysics of human movement, and applications to exercise and therapeutic rehabilitation. Includes instruction in biomechanics, motor behavior, motor development and coordination, motor neurophysiology, performance research, rehabilitative therapies, the development of diagnostic and rehabilitative methods and equipment, and related analytical methods and procedures in applied exercise and therapeutic rehabilitation.

Students must complete various science and fitness courses to understand how the human body responds to exercise. Courses such as the following will teach you to assess health needs and tailor exercise routines to address those concerns appropriately:
- Anatomy
- Physiology
- Chemistry
- Nutrition
- Psychology
Exercise scientists are healthcare professionals who optimize wellness goals through exercise and nutrition. Here are examples of career opportunities:
- Fitness Specialist
- Strength And Conditioning Specialist
- Medical Fitness and Rehabilitation
- Coaching
- Disability Studies
